Levels of osteoclastogenesis-related factors in the peri-implant crevicular fluid and clinical parameters of immediately loaded implants in patients with osteopenia: a short-term report.

作者信息

Onuma Tatiana, Aquiar Kelly, Duarte Poliana Mendes, Feres Magda, Giro Gabriela, Coelho Paulo, Cassoni Alessandra, Shibli Jamil Awad

出版信息

Int J Oral Maxillofac Implants. 2015 Nov-Dec;30(6):1431-6. doi: 10.11607/jomi.3943. Epub 2015 Oct 16.

Abstract

PURPOSE

The aim of this prospective controlled study was to evaluate the influence of osteopenia on the levels of osteoclastogenesis-related factors in the peri-implant crevicular fluid (PICF) and on the clinical parameters of immediately loaded implants.

MATERIALS AND METHODS

This study included 24 patients who received at least two implants in the mandible, with restorations delivered 48 hours after implant placement. Patients were divided into control (n = 11) and osteopenia (n = 13) groups. Seven days after implant placement (baseline) and 4 months after implant placement, PICF samples were obtained, and clinical parameters (Plaque Index, Gingival Index, bleeding on probing, suppuration, probing depths, clinical attachment levels) were measured. A commercially available enzyme-linked immunosorbent assay was used to analyze PICF samples for levels of soluble receptor activator of nuclear factor of κB ligand (sRANKL) and osteoprotegerin (OPG). At the 4-month follow-up visit, the implant-supported restorations were removed and periapical radiographs were acquired to evaluate bone loss around the implants.

RESULTS

Eighty-eight immediately loaded implants were included in this study (38 in the control group, 50 in the osteopenia group). The RANKL and OPG levels, the RANKL/OPG ratio, and the clinical parameters were similar between the groups at both time points. However, the levels of these factors in PICF differed significantly between baseline and 4 months after surgery.

CONCLUSION

Within the limitations of this short-term study, it can be concluded that osteopenia does not influence the PICF levels of osteoclastogenesis-related factors in immediately loaded implants after 4 months of loading.

摘要

目的

本前瞻性对照研究旨在评估骨质减少对种植体周围龈沟液(PICF)中破骨细胞生成相关因子水平以及即刻负重种植体临床参数的影响。

材料与方法

本研究纳入24例在下颌骨接受至少两颗种植体的患者,种植体植入后48小时进行修复。患者分为对照组(n = 11)和骨质减少组(n = 13)。在种植体植入后7天(基线)和植入后4个月,采集PICF样本,并测量临床参数(菌斑指数、牙龈指数、探诊出血、化脓、探诊深度、临床附着水平)。使用市售酶联免疫吸附测定法分析PICF样本中核因子κB受体活化因子配体(sRANKL)和骨保护素(OPG)的水平。在4个月的随访时,拆除种植体支持的修复体并拍摄根尖片以评估种植体周围的骨吸收情况。

结果

本研究共纳入88颗即刻负重种植体(对照组38颗,骨质减少组50颗)。在两个时间点,两组之间的RANKL和OPG水平、RANKL/OPG比值以及临床参数均相似。然而,PICF中这些因子的水平在基线和术后4个月之间存在显著差异。

结论

在这项短期研究的局限性范围内,可以得出结论,骨质减少在负重4个月后不会影响即刻负重种植体中破骨细胞生成相关因子的PICF水平。
